Re: Michael Avenatti
Quote:
Originally Posted by Hank Chinaski
As of now, he has 1 porn star client, and he likes to talk about himself. I exposed my dick on film once and I like to talk about myself. Let's see what else the paisan can do before we line to suck his dick.
|
Either you didn’t look at the link that Less provided, or multi-million dollar verdicts (non-PI) don’t give you an idea what the paisan can do.
Avenatti has also served as lead counsel on a number of historically large cases, including an April 2017 $454 million verdict after a jury trial in Federal Court in Los Angeles in a fraud case against Kimberly-Clark and Halyard Health,[30] later reduced to a $21.7 million dollar verdict upon appeal,[31] an $80.5 million class-action settlement against Service Corporation International,[32] a $41 million jury verdict against KPMG,[33] and a $39 million malicious prosecution settlement.[34]
Doesn’t mean he’ll recover for Stormy (Popehat thinks his defamation claims are weak), but it seems to me that he’s more than just a guy who likes to see himself on the teeveee
